Account Creation and Initial Security Layers
The security journey with crorebet casino begins at the point of registration. A robust account creation process is the first line of defense against unauthorized access. This goes beyond simply requesting an email address and password. Typically, the platform will require verification of your email address through a confirmation link sent to your inbox. This verifies that the provided email is legitimate and accessible to the user and not created for malicious purposes. Furthermore, stronger password requirements are in place, often mandating a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ters. The goal is to discourage weak or easily guessable passwords, which are common targets for hackers.
Two-Factor Authentication (2FA) Implementation
Beyond basic password security, crorebet casino presumably offers, or should offer, two-factor authentication. This is an extra layer of security that requires a second form of verification in addition to your password. This could be a code sent to your mobile phone via SMS, a time-based one-time password generated by an authenticator app (like Google Authenticator or Authy), or even biometric verification. Enabling 2FA significantly reduces the risk of unauthorized account access, even if your password is compromised. It is critical for users to activate this feature when available, as it provides a substantial boost to their account security.

Regular monitoring of login activity and IP address tracking are also vital components. The system flags any unusual login attempts, such as logins from unfamiliar locations or after multiple failed attempts. This allows the security team to investigate potentially fraudulent activity and protect accounts from unauthorized access. These initial security measures collectively create a strong foundation for a secure gaming experience.
Financial Transactions and Data Encryption
Protecting financial transactions is paramount for any online casino. crorebet casino utilizes advanced encryption technologies to safeguard sensitive financial data during deposits and withdrawals. The industry standard is S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, which creates a secure connection between the player's device and the casino's servers. This encryption scrambles the data, making it unreadable to anyone who might intercept it. The presence of a padlock icon in the browser address bar indicates that a website is using SSL encryption.
Secure Payment Gateway Integration
Beyond SSL encryption, crorebet casino integrates with reputable and secure payment gateways. These gateways act as intermediaries between the casino and the player’s bank or credit card company, adding another layer of security. These gateways are P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) compliant, meaning they adhere to strict security standards for handling credit card information. The casino itself avoids directly storing sensitive credit card details, relying on the secure payment gateway to process the transactions. This minimizes the risk of data breaches and protects player's financial information. Accepting a variety of payment methods, like credit/debit cards, e-wallets, and even cryptocurrencies, doesn’t weaken security if these are handled via established secure gateways.

Tokenization, where sensitive data is replaced with a non-sensitive equivalent, also plays a role in enhancing security. The casino doesn't store your actual credit card number; instead, it stores a token that represents that number. This means that even if the casino’s database is compromised, the attackers won't gain access to your actual financial information. These practices ensure that financial transactions are conducted securely and protect players from fraud.
Withdrawal Procedures and Verification Processes
The withdrawal process is another critical area where security is paramount. crorebet casino implements stringent verification procedures to ensure that funds are only transferred to the legitimate account holder. This often involves requesting documentation to verify the player’s identity and address. Common documents requested include a copy of a government-issued photo ID (like a passport or driver's license) and proof of address (like a utility bill or bank statement). This is an industry standard practice known as KYC (Know Your Customer) and it is designed to prevent fraud, money laundering, and other illegal activities.
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Compliance
The verification process is not merely about preventing fraud; it’s also about complying with anti-money laundering (AML) regulations. Online casinos are subject to strict AML laws, which require them to verify the source of funds and report any suspicious activity. This helps to prevent the casino from being used for illegal purposes. The withdrawal process may also involve checks for any unusual activity or discrepancies. For example, if a player suddenly requests a large withdrawal after a period of inactivity, the casino may investigate further to ensure that the funds are not derived from illegal sources. These measures are in place to protect both the casino and its players.

Data Protection and Privacy Policies
Beyond financial security, crorebet casino must also protect players’ personal data. This is governed by comprehensive privacy policies and data protection practices. The casino should clearly outline how it collects, uses, and protects player data. This includes information such as name, address, email address, and date of birth. Data should be stored securely on encrypted servers and only accessed by authorized personnel. Players should have the right to access, correct, or delete their personal data, in accordance with data protection regulations.
Regular data security audits and penetration testing are essential to identify and address vulnerabilities. These audits involve independent security experts who attempt to breach the casino’s security systems. Any vulnerabilities discovered are promptly addressed to prevent potential data breaches. The casino also implements robust firewalls and intrusion detection systems to protect its servers from unauthorized access. These measures demonstrate a commitment to protecting player privacy and data security. Maintaining data privacy is not just a legal obligation but also a core tenet of building player trust.
Incident Response and Ongoing Security Enhancements
Despite all preventative measures, security breaches can still occur. Therefore, crorebet casino must have a well-defined incident response plan in place. This plan outlines the steps to be taken in the event of a security breach, including identifying the source of the breach, containing the damage, and notifying affected players. Transparency is key during an incident – players should be informed promptly and accurately about the breach and the steps being taken to address it. Regular security updates and software patches are also crucial to stay ahead of evolving threats. The online security landscape is constantly changing, so continuous improvement is essential.
Proactive threat intelligence gathering and participation in industry security forums are vital for staying informed about the latest threats and vulnerabilities. The casino can leverage this information to enhance its security defenses and protect its players from emerging threats. Investing in ongoing security training for employees is also essential. Employees are often the first line of defense against cyberattacks, so they need to be aware of the latest threats and how to identify and report them. A culture of security awareness throughout the organization is critical for maintaining a robust security posture.
